Chloroprocaine

Chloroprocaine Brand Names CLOROTEKAL | Nesacaine | Nesacaine MPF What is Chloroprocaine Chloroprocaine is a short-acting local anesthetic of the ester type, similar in structure to procaine. Chloroprocaine is indicated for infiltration anesthesia and peripheral, sympathetic, epidural, caudal, subarachnoid, and intravenous regional (Bier’s method) blocks. Chlordiazepoxide Clidinium

Chlordiazepoxide Clidinium Brand Name– Librax What is Chlordiazepoxide Clidinium Chlordiazepoxide and clidinium are a benzodiazepine and an antimuscarinic, respectively, used together in an oral preparation to control emotional and somatic factors in gastrointestinal disorders. Chlordiazepoxide

Chlordiazepoxide Brand Name– Librium What is Chlordiazepoxide Chlordiazepoxide is a long-acting oral and parenteral benzodiazepine used to manage symptoms associated with anxiety disorders. Chlordiazepoxide also has been used for many years in the management of ethanol withdrawal, but many clinicians now prefer lorazepam because it is shorter acting and has no active metabolites. Chlorcyclizine

Chlorcyclizine Brand Name– AHIST What is Chlorcyclizine Chlorcyclizine is an oral sedating, phenylpiperazine antihistamine (H1-blocker) that is structurally related to cyclizine, hydroxyzine, and meclizine. Chlorcyclizine is effective in treating symptoms due to hay fever and other upper respiratory allergies. It has also been used to relieve urticaria, pruritus, and emesis. Chlorambucil

Chlorambucil Brand Name– Leukeran What is Chlorambucil Chlorambucil is an oral alkylating agent. Chlorambucil is approved for use as palliative treatment of chronic lymphocytic leukemia, Hodgkin lymphoma, and certain non-Hodgkin’s lymphomas including lymphosarcoma and giant follicular lymphoma.
